A Test Engineer designs and executes assessments to ensure software quality and functionality. Responsibilities encompass creating check plans, figuring out defects, and taking part with development groups to resolve issues. They use computerized and guide testing techniques, analyze effects, and maintain particular documentation to enhance software program reliability and overall performance.
- Job Role: Test Engineer
- Salary: ₹5L–₹14.6L per year
- Location: Pune, Maharashtra
- Company: Barclays
- Qualification: Engineering/BTech/MCA
About Company:

Barclays is a British multinational regularly occurring financial institution, established in London. Founded in 1690, it operates via two middle divisions: Barclays UK and Barclays International, supported through its carrier corporation, Barclays Execution Services. The financial institution affords a range of economic offerings such as retail banking, credit playing cards, wholesale banking, investment banking, wealth control, and investment management. Barclays is listed on the London Stock Exchange and New York Stock Exchange. With a worldwide presence in over forty countries, Barclays is known for its sizable contributions to the development of financial markets and its innovation in banking generation.
Role Overview:
Barclays is hiring a Test Engineer in Pune, Maharashtra. This everlasting function involves taking a look at planning, execution, and automation for diverse initiatives. Candidates need to have reveled in API automation by trying out, CI/CD, Agile methodologies, and equipment like Selenium and JIRA. Barclays values flexible, hybrid running and emphasizes respect, integrity, service, excellence, and stewardship. The function gives possibilities for worldwide collaboration and impactful initiatives.
Roles and Responsibilities Of Test Engineer:
Test Planning and Strategy:
Test Engineers are accountable for growing complete test plans that define the scope, technique, resources, and schedule of supposed take a look at sports. This includes defining the targets, choosing appropriate checking out equipment, and figuring out the take a look at environmental necessities.
Test Case Development:
They expand certain check instances based on software requirements and layout documents. These take a look at cases and make certain thorough coverage of practical and non-functional requirements, encompassing side instances, boundary conditions, and poor scenarios.
Test Execution:
Test Engineers execute the prepared test cases at the software software, systematically identifying defects. This includes both guide trying out and automatic testing strategies. They meticulously record the outcomes, capturing any deviations from predicted outcomes.
Defect Reporting and Tracking:
When defects are recognized, Test Engineers log them in a defect tracking gadget with specific information to facilitate replication and resolution. They work closely with developers to communicate issues, music the development of worm fixes, and retest resolved issues.

Skills Required For Test Engineer:
Automation Testing Proficiency:
Test Engineers must be adept at the use of automation equipment like Selenium, JUnit, or TestNG. This skill entails writing scripts and growing automatic checks to ensure the software is fine, which helps in growing test coverage, and efficiency, and reducing guide trying-out efforts.
Programming Knowledge:
A solid expertise in programming languages inclusive of Java, Python, or C# is important. This ability lets Test Engineers put in writing automatic tests, recognize the software program’s codebase, and correctly speak with builders approximately ability troubles.
Analytical and Problem-Solving Skills:
These competencies are essential for figuring out, analyzing, and troubleshooting problems in the software. Test Engineers need to think significantly to recognize complex systems, expect ability failures, and devise appropriate take a look at cases and strategies.
Understanding of Software Development Life Cycle (SDLC):
Test Engineers should have complete knowledge of the SDLC, which includes Agile and DevOps methodologies. This know-how guarantees they can integrate testing seamlessly into the improvement system, take part in non-stop integration/continuous deployment (CI/CD) pipelines, and ensure sure timely delivery of outstanding software programs.
Why Barclays?
Innovative Projects: Engage in present-day monetary technology and innovative answers that form the banking industry.
Career Growth: Benefit from robust schooling programs, expert improvement possibilities, and clean professional development paths.
Collaborative Environment: Work in a various and inclusive group, fostering collaboration and know-how sharing across worldwide teams.
Competitive Benefits: Enjoy comprehensive benefits, such as health insurance, retirement plans, and performance bonuses.
Work-Life Balance: Experience a supportive work way of life that values work-life balance with flexible running hours and far-flung painting alternatives.
Other Jobs:
Next racker is Hiring a Mechanical Test Engineer
Caterpillar Hiring Software Test Engineer
Join Airtel As a Software Engineer Job
Wipro Hiring Test Engineer Job in Bengaluru